Resolution of Overlapping Branes
Abstract
We obtain singularity resolutions for various overlapping brane configurations, including those of two heterotic 5-branes, type II 5-branes or D4-branes. In these solutions, the ``harmonic'' function H for each brane component depends only on the associated four-dimensional relative transverse space. The resolution is achieved by replacing these transverse spaces with Eguchi-Hanson or Taub-NUT spaces, both of which admit a normalisable self-dual (or anti-self-dual) harmonic 2-form. Due to the manner in which the interaction terms for the form fields modify their Bianchi identities or equations of motion, these normalisable harmonic 2-forms provide regular sources for the branes. We also obtain resolved 5-branes and D4-branes wrapped on S^1, which is fibred over the transverse Eguchi-Hanson or Taub-NUT spaces. The T-duality invariance of the NS-NS 5-brane is retained after the resolution. The resolved 5-branes and D4-branes provide regular supergravity duals of certain supersymmetric Yang-Mills theories in five and four dimensions.
